Electricity Prices in Polo, IL
Residential Electricity Rates in Polo
Residential electricity prices in Polo, IL in August 2025 averaged approximately 18.09 cents per kilowatthour (¢/kWh), which was about 3% more than the national average rate of 17.62 ¢/kWh (August 2025). [1]

On a year-over-year basis - from July 2024 to July 2025 - residential electricity prices in Polo increased approximately 14%, from 15.19 ¢/kWh to 17.25 ¢/kWh. [1]

Natural Gas Prices in Polo, IL
Residential Natural Gas Rates in Polo
Residential natural gas prices in Polo in August 2025 averaged 23.23 dollars per thousand cubic feet ($/Mcf), which was approximately 14% less than the national average rate of 26.88 $/Mcf (August 2025). [2]

On a year-over-year basis, residential natural gas prices in Polo (Illinois) increased approximately 10%, from 20.78 $/Mcf (July 2024) to 22.81 $/Mcf (July 2025). [2]
